Course Content

• Understanding Water Resources and Scarcity
• Transboundary Water Management & Governance
• Water Conflict Analysis & Mediation Techniques
• Negotiation & Dispute Resolution in Water Resources
• Water Allocation & Institutional Frameworks
• Environmental Law and Water Rights
• Community Participation & Stakeholder Engagement in Water Management
• Water Conflict Resolution Methods: Case Studies and Best Practices
• Conflict Prevention and Early Warning Systems for Water Resources

Career Role Description
Water Conflict Mediator (International Development) Resolving disputes between stakeholders in international water projects, demanding expertise in negotiation and cross-cultural communication. High demand for skilled professionals.
Water Resources Analyst (Environmental Consulting) Analyzing water resource management strategies, assessing risks, and proposing solutions for sustainable water use, using data analysis and conflict resolution skills. Strong growth potential.
Water Policy Advocate (Government/NGO) Developing and advocating for water policies that promote equitable access and sustainable management. Requires strong advocacy and conflict resolution skills.
Water Diplomacy Specialist (International Relations) Negotiating water-related agreements between countries, resolving transboundary water disputes, and promoting cooperation. High demand for experienced professionals.
